What is the salary of a Corrections Shift Supervisor? In the United States, a Corrections Shift Supervisor earns an average salary of $63,417. The salary range for a Corrections Shift Supervisor is usually between $60,836 and $66,027 per year, representing the 25th to 75th percentiles respectively. The top 10% of earners, that is the 90th percentile, have an annual salary of $79,694. The highest Corrections Shift Supervisor salary in the United States was $79,694. The average hourly pay for a Corrections Shift Supervisor is $30.49.
